Perfect Mike Fisher pass leads to Craig Smith goal

Nashville’s second line has had a productive night against Minnesota.

Mike Fisher’s production has been a pleasant surprise this year. After missing extended time with an Achilles injury, the veteran forward has registered 32 points (14 goals, 18 assists) in 41 contests -- providing Nashville with some much-needed scoring depth.

Thursday's matchup against Minnesota is shaping up to be one of his best in recent memory. A goal 16 seconds into the middle frame tied the game at one, and several minutes later, he chipped a beautiful pass to linemate Craig Smith, who drove to the net and beat Wild goalie Devan Dubnyk. With this tally, Smith reached the 20-goal mark for the second consecutive season.
